There is one major missing piece, I do not know how to word it properly. 
Let's try: Linas' algorithm does build a model in a way that is 
unsupervised that can predict the linguistic structure of a sentence. With 
that model, Every word part a sentence can be attached to half a directed 
link, in the spirit of Link Grammar, then when the sentence make sense, 
there is complete linkage of the sentence with full directed links. Where 
does a link label come from?
